What is glutamine?

Glutamine is a conditionally essential amino acid, meaning that while your body can produce it naturally, under stress, like hard training or illness, demand can exceed supply. It’s found in the blood and muscle tissue, where it plays critical roles in:

  • Muscle repair and recovery: Glutamine supports protein synthesis, helping repair damaged muscle fibres after workouts.
  • Immune function: It fuels immune cells, helping your body fend off infections, especially when under physical stress.
  • Gut health: Glutamine is a key fuel source for intestinal cells, helping maintain a strong and healthy gut lining.
  • Nitrogen transport: It helps shuttle nitrogen around the body, which is vital for muscle growth and recovery.

Because it’s involved in so many systems, maintaining healthy glutamine levels supports both performance and overall wellbeing.

How glutamine supplements work in the body

When you consume glutamine supplements, the amino acid enters the bloodstream and is rapidly taken up by tissues such as the intestines and immune cells before reaching the muscles. This makes it a somewhat complex nutrient to supplement effectively, as much of it is used before it ever reaches muscle tissue.

Still, studies suggest that supplementing glutamine may benefit people under heavy training loads or those recovering from injury or illness. The idea is that by boosting available glutamine, you reduce catabolism (muscle breakdown) and improve your body’s ability to recover and maintain immune health.

Potential benefits of glutamine supplements

Here’s a look at the main potential benefits people seek from glutamine supplements, backed by current research and practical experience.

Glutamine is known for being versatile, offering different effects depending on training style, diet, and recovery habits.

  • Enhanced muscle recovery: Some research suggests that glutamine supplementation may reduce muscle soreness and speed up recovery after intense training, especially when combined with other amino acids or protein sources.
  • Immune system support: During periods of overtraining or calorie restriction, immune function can decline. Glutamine helps maintain a healthy immune response, potentially reducing downtime due to illness.
  • Gut support and digestion: Athletes often experience digestive stress due to high-protein diets or supplement use. Glutamine can help soothe the gut and support better nutrient absorption.
  • Reduced muscle breakdown: When energy levels are low, the body may break down muscle tissue for fuel. Glutamine helps minimise this catabolic effect by providing an alternative energy source for cells.
  • Improved hydration balance: Glutamine aids in cellular hydration and may improve endurance during long training sessions when paired with electrolytes.

Nutritional sources of glutamine

Before jumping straight to supplementation, it’s worth noting that glutamine is naturally found in many protein-rich foods. Including these foods in your diet can help maintain steady glutamine levels and support recovery naturally.

Some of the best natural sources include:

  • Beef and chicken: Excellent animal-based sources of glutamine that support muscle maintenance and recovery.
  • Eggs and dairy products: Provide both glutamine and other key amino acids needed for growth and repair.
  • Fish: Another quality source, especially beneficial when combined with omega-3 fatty acids for overall inflammation control.
  • Tofu and legumes: Great plant-based options for vegans or vegetarians, offering solid glutamine content alongside fibre.
  • Cabbage, spinach, and parsley: While lower in protein, these vegetables still provide modest amounts of glutamine to support gut health.

By focusing on a well-balanced, protein-rich diet, many people can maintain sufficient glutamine levels without relying solely on supplements. However, athletes under heavy physical stress may still benefit from targeted supplementation to fill the gaps.

When to take glutamine for best results

Timing can influence how effectively glutamine supplements work, though the optimal window depends on your goals.

Here are the most common and effective times to take glutamine:

  • Post-workout: This is the most popular time, as your body’s glutamine stores are typically lowest after intense exercise. It may help speed up recovery and reduce soreness.
  • Before bed: Taking glutamine before sleep can support overnight repair processes, especially if combined with casein or another slow-digesting protein.
  • First thing in the morning: For those training fasted or following a low-carb diet, glutamine in the morning can support gut health and immune function.
  • With meals: Some people take smaller doses throughout the day with food to maintain steady levels, particularly during high-volume training phases.

Possible drawbacks and limitations

While glutamine is generally safe and well-tolerated, it’s not a magic bullet for muscle growth. Research on its direct impact on performance and recovery in well-fed, healthy individuals is mixed.

Keep in mind a few potential limitations and side points:

  • Limited muscle impact: Most glutamine absorbed from supplements is used by the intestines and immune system before reaching muscle tissue.
  • Best for stressed or depleted states: The greatest benefits tend to appear when the body is under stress, such as after illness, injury, or extreme training.
  • Not essential for all athletes: If you already consume adequate protein through whole foods and shakes, you’re likely getting sufficient glutamine naturally.
  • High doses unnecessary: Most benefits are achieved with moderate dosing (5–10 g per day), and higher doses don’t appear to add extra value.

Who should consider glutamine supplements

Glutamine supplements aren’t essential for everyone, but they can be particularly beneficial for people with specific training demands or recovery needs.

Here’s who might benefit most:

  • Endurance athletes engaging in long-duration sessions where glycogen depletion is common.
  • Bodybuilders during intense cutting phases when calorie intake is low.
  • Athletes recovering from injury or illness who need extra support for immune function and muscle maintenance.
  • Individuals with digestive issues who want to support gut lining repair.
  • Those under chronic stress or sleep deprivation, as these conditions can deplete glutamine levels.

Frequently asked questions

Is glutamine safe to take every day?

Yes, glutamine supplements are generally safe for daily use at standard doses (5–10 g per day). Always follow manufacturer guidelines.

Do I need glutamine if I already eat a high-protein diet?

Not necessarily. Most people consuming enough protein from food (like meat, dairy, and eggs) already get sufficient glutamine, but supplementation can help during intense training or recovery phases.

Can glutamine cause stomach upset?

It’s rare, but high doses might cause mild digestive discomfort. Start with smaller servings to test your tolerance.

Can I mix glutamine with my protein shake?

Absolutely. It mixes easily with most shakes and can be combined with whey or casein without any issues.

Our verdict on glutamine supplements

When it comes to muscle recovery, glutamine supplements can play a helpful, though not essential, role. Their benefits are most noticeable during times of stress, illness, or extreme training, when your body’s natural glutamine levels may dip. If your diet is already rich in protein, you might not see dramatic changes — but for athletes pushing their limits, glutamine offers solid immune, gut, and recovery support.

In short, glutamine is a reliable addition to a recovery stack rather than a standalone game-changer. Use it strategically when training volume spikes, or when your immune system feels run down. For many lifters and endurance athletes, it’s a low-risk supplement that helps maintain performance and recovery balance. Combined with sound nutrition and rest, glutamine can be part of a complete plan to stay strong and recover faster.
